¿Cómo utilizar una entrada analógica? En el caso de las entradas analógicas, debemos saber que los valores de la carga siempre se encuentran variando, incluso, pueden tomar cualquier valor que se necesario. Esto puede ser ventajoso en aquellos circuitos donde se precise de esta característica en el pin que se usará.

En cada uno de los ciclos de carga, o en el caso del paso de la energía, a medida que aumenta, entonces se marcará como positivo, caso contrario cuando disminuye la carga, pasa a ser negativa, en todo caso, se determinará cada uno de los resultados. Ahora bien, comencemos a ver algunos aspectos importantes sobre la utilización de las entradas analógicas.

Propiedades de las señales análogas

En cuanto a las propiedades de las señales análogas, podemos encontrar dos. De las que detallaremos a continuación:

  • En cuanto a los valores: se refiere a los valores en voltios que tienden a definirse en 0 o en 1. En el caso de una placa Arduino, va desde 0 V hasta 5 V.
  • En cuanto a la propiedad de la resolución análoga: en este respecto, se refiere al número de bits que suelen representar una señal analógica.

Ahora bien, es posible atribuir propiedades diversas a los pines en un circuito Arduino. Por lo tanto, podemos enmarcar algunas de estas propiedades conforme queremos especificar algunos valores determinantes.

Funciones para las entradas análogas

En este punto hablaremos de las funciones de las entradas análogas, lo que nos ayudará a transcribir de forma correcta, cada uno de los mandos a los que podemos acceder y programar. Veamos pues, cómo debe ser en lenguaje Arduino:

  1. Para configurar la referencia del voltaje, es necesario usar la siguiente función analogReference(), en caso que la entrada sea análoga.
  2. En caso que se quiera leer el valor de un pin, entonces introduce la siguiente función: analogRead().
  3. Para escribir el valor análogo de un pin específico en PWM, se escribirá la siguiente función analogWrite().

Especificaciones de las salidas de PWM

En cuanto a las salidas de PWM, es importante tener en cuenta que si queremos generar salidas analógicas de pines digitales. En el caso de aquellos Arduino de modelo UNO, tienen salidas análogas puras con las que podemos contar al momento de la programación.

En caso de que se quieran hacer salidas análogas, es posible encontrar la librería necesaria para lograrlo; y que de seguro, encontrarás en la web. Como por ejemplo: https://www.arduino.cc/en/Reference/Audio.

Construye el circuito en tus salidas análogas

Al momento en que hemos encontrado el circuito; podemos comenzar a usar los pines para realizar las entradas que necesitamos al momento de programar. Ahora bien; siguiendo con las funciones que hemos especificado anteriormente, se podrá construir el código necesario. Incluso, podemos hallar códigos para entradas de audio.

A propósito de eso; siempre podemos optar por determinar el uso de los pines, teniendo en cuenta que, tendrán los valores que queremos administrar en el circuito y de paso, sostener estos valores en cada proyecto.